Timing advance....would a timing plate or timing key be best? WHat are the gains?

Shaving head.....maybe .030-.040? Again, what gains could I expect?

Anyway, I have shaved my head .040 and I did notice a diffence in performance. I seemed to gain some low end power, whcih is where the Banshee needs help. I dont have the timing advance key, but a buddy of mine has one and it did make his perform better. Early in the summer I was beating him by a couple of quads,then he got the timing key and well, he was not getting beat quite as bad. I would recommend both of those mode. So .040 did'nt get you into any clatter or detonation? I have heard that .040-.045 is about the limit on pump gas. We normally ride around 0-2000 feet above sea level.

If shaving the head and the key can each pick up a lenght or 2 in a drag, then it would be worth it.

No, i think .040 would be pretty just right, problem is, I was riding at about 8000 feet of elevation, but that is what was recommended to me from people at sea level. I actually could have gone to .060, but knew I was moving to Phoenix soon. YOu will definitely pick up a few more lengths...These are actually the two most inexpensive mods that can be done to the Banshee. To me the cool-head is a waste of money, they dont seem to actually cool the motor anymore.
